第一步:打開根目錄下 extend/function.php 文件(此文件是用戶可以自定義函數(shù)的php文件,官方升級長久不會覆蓋);
第二步:在末尾回車換行,復(fù)制以下代碼粘貼在最末尾處;
if (!function_exists(‘diy_getArcrank’))
{
/**
* 顯示文檔的會員閱讀權(quán)限名稱
* @param string $arcrank 會員閱讀權(quán)限值
* @return [type] 會員級別名稱
*/
function diy_getArcrank($arcrank = ”)
{
static $users_level_list = [];
if (empty($users_level_list)) {
$users_level_list = thinkDb::name(‘users_level’)->field(‘level_name,level_value’)
->where(‘lang’, get_current_lang())
->order(‘is_system desc, level_value asc’)
->getAllWithIndex(‘level_value’);
}
if (!empty($users_level_list[$arcrank])) {
return $users_level_list[$arcrank][‘level_name’];
} else if (empty($arcrank)) {
$firstUserLevel = current($users_level_list);
return $firstUserLevel[‘level_name’];
} else {
return ”;
}
}
}
如圖所示:打開文件extendfunction.php
第三步:在模板的列表標簽里(arclist / list)進行調(diào)用;
{$field.arcrank|diy_getArcrank=###}
版權(quán)聲明: 本站資源均來自互聯(lián)網(wǎng)或會員發(fā)布,如果侵犯了您的權(quán)益請與我們聯(lián)系,我們將在24小時內(nèi)刪除!謝謝!
轉(zhuǎn)載請注明: 易優(yōu)CMS文檔列表怎么調(diào)取會員閱讀權(quán)限的名稱